Imej mungkin representasi.
Lihat spesifikasi untuk butiran produk.
PIC18F2585-H/SP

PIC18F2585-H/SP

Product Overview

Category

The PIC18F2585-H/SP bel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ic applications that require embedded control and processing capabilities.

Characteristics

  • High-performance 8-bit architecture
  • Flash memory for program storage
  • Integrated peripherals for versatile functionality
  • Low power consumption
  • Wide operating voltage range
  • Robust communication interfaces
  • Enhanced security features

Package

The PIC18F2585-H/SP is available in a small outline, plastic dual inline package (DIP).

Essence

The essence of this microcontroller lies in its ability to provide efficient and reliable control and processing capabilities in a compact form factor.

Packaging/Quantity

The PIC18F2585-H/SP is typically packaged in reels or tubes, with quantities varying based on customer requirements.

Specifications

  • Microcontroller Family: PIC18F
  • CPU Speed: Up to 40 MHz
  • Program Memory Size: 32 KB
  • RAM Size: 2 KB
  • Number of I/O Pins: 25
  • ADC Channels: 10-bit, 13 channels
  • Communication Interfaces: UART, SPI, I2C
  • Operating Voltage Range: 2.0V to 5.5V
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The PIC18F2585-H/SP has a total of 28 pins, each serving a specific purpose. The pin configuration is as follows:

  1. VDD - Power supply voltage
  2. RA0 - General-purpose I/O pin
  3. RA1 - General-purpose I/O pin
  4. RA2 - General-purpose I/O pin
  5. RA3 - General-purpose I/O pin
  6. RA4 - General-purpose I/O pin
  7. RA5 - General-purpose I/O pin
  8. VSS - Ground
  9. OSC1/CLKIN - Oscillator input
  10. OSC2/CLKOUT - Oscillator output
  11. RC0 - General-purpose I/O pin
  12. RC1 - General-purpose I/O pin
  13. RC2 - General-purpose I/O pin
  14. RC3 - General-purpose I/O pin
  15. RC4 - General-purpose I/O pin
  16. RC5 - General-purpose I/O pin
  17. RB0/INT0 - External interrupt input
  18. RB1/INT1 - External interrupt input
  19. RB2/INT2 - External interrupt input
  20. RB3/INT3 - External interrupt input
  21. RB4 - General-purpose I/O pin
  22. RB5 - General-purpose I/O pin
  23. RB6 - General-purpose I/O pin
  24. RB7 - General-purpose I/O pin
  25. RB8 - General-purpose I/O pin
  26. RB9 - General-purpose I/O pin
  27. RB10 - General-purpose I/O pin
  28. MCLR/VPP - Master Clear/Voltage Programming Pin

Functional Features

The PIC18F2585-H/SP offers a range of functional features that enhance its versatility and performance. Some notable features include:

  • Enhanced Capture/Compare/PWM (ECCP) module for advanced motor control applications
  • Analog-to-Digital Converter (ADC) for precise analog signal measurement
  • Serial Communication Modules (USART, SPI, I2C) for seamless data transfer
  • Timers and Counters for accurate timing and event management
  • Interrupt handling capabilities for real-time responsiveness
  • Flash memory with self-programming capability for easy firmware updates
  • Low-power modes for energy-efficient operation
  • Built-in security features to protect against unauthorized access

Advantages and Disadvantages

Advantages

  • High-performance architecture enables efficient processing of complex tasks
  • Wide operating voltage range allows compatibility with various power sources
  • Integrated peripherals simplify system design and reduce external component count
  • Low power consumption prolongs battery life in portable applications
  • Enhanced security features provide protection against unauthorized access

Disadvantages

  • Limited program memory size may restrict the complexity of applications
  • Restricted number of I/O pins may limit the connectivity options in some designs
  • Lack of built-in wireless communication modules may require additional components for wireless connectivity

Working Principles

The PIC18F2585-H/SP operates based on the Harvard architecture, which separates program and data memory. It executes instructions fetched from the program memory and manipulates data stored in the data memory. The microcontroller's central processing unit (CPU) coordinates the execution of instructions and interacts with the integrated peripherals to perform various tasks.

Detailed Application Field Plans

The PIC18F2585-H/SP finds application in a wide range of fields, including but not limited to:

  1. Industrial Automation: Control

Senaraikan 10 soalan dan jawapan biasa yang berkaitan dengan aplikasi PIC18F2585-H/SP dalam penyelesaian teknikal

  1. What is the maximum operating frequency of PIC18F2585-H/SP?
    - The maximum operating frequency of PIC18F2585-H/SP is 40 MHz.

  2. What are the key features of PIC18F2585-H/SP?
    - Some key features of PIC18F2585-H/SP include 32 KB flash program memory, 1536 bytes of data EEPROM, and 25 I/O pins.

  3. Can PIC18F2585-H/SP be used in automotive applications?
    - Yes, PIC18F2585-H/SP is suitable for automotive applications due to its robust design and wide operating voltage range.

  4. How many timers does PIC18F2585-H/SP have?
    - PIC18F2585-H/SP has three timers: Timer0, Timer1, and Timer2.

  5. Is PIC18F2585-H/SP compatible with USB communication?
    - No, PIC18F2585-H/SP does not have built-in USB functionality.

  6. What programming languages can be used to program PIC18F2585-H/SP?
    - PIC18F2585-H/SP can be programmed using C, Assembly, and other high-level languages supported by Microchip's MPLAB IDE.

  7. Does PIC18F2585-H/SP have analog-to-digital conversion (ADC) capability?
    - Yes, PIC18F2585-H/SP has a 10-bit ADC module with multiple channels.

  8. Can PIC18F2585-H/SP operate in low-power modes?
    - Yes, PIC18F2585-H/SP supports various low-power modes to conserve energy in battery-powered applications.

  9. What communication interfaces are available on PIC18F2585-H/SP?
    - PIC18F2585-H/SP features USART, SPI, and I2C communication interfaces for connecting to external devices.

  10. Is PIC18F2585-H/SP suitable for industrial control applications?
    - Yes, PIC18F2585-H/SP is well-suited for industrial control applications due to its robust peripherals and reliability.